What is Lithographic Print? Litho (lithographic) printing is a form of print that uses a flat surface, generally an aluminium plate to transfer an image to paper.

CMYK or Spot Colour? CMYK Cyan, Magenta, Yellow and Black Create colours by mixing these four colours Spot Colour Pantone References Cannot be mixed from CMYK

Issues with Designers Often printers have trouble with files not meeting print requirements: CMYK or Spot Colour Overlays and transparencies Layering and knock-out Bleed Print requirements are not taught on design courses.

Creating the plates Plates can be made one of two ways Manually from negative films Automatically from files Printing Plate CTP Machine
